Welcome to the Arts In Motion website. Let me introduce myself. I’m John Careless, and I am an artist based in the West Midlands of the UK.

 

I have been drawn to art ever since I was a young boy, and from an early age, my father would encourage me to draw.

Ever since that time I’ve had an interest in all forms of art, and have tried my hand at most genres, including, wood burning, glass engraving, and even cartoon sketching. 

 

In 1985 while serving in the Army, I began drawing cartoons for a UK based American football magazine. Later that year, I was commissioned to illustrate a monthly cartoon, “The Survivalist”, for a magazine called Combat and Survival.

 

Two years later in 1987, along with my friend Nick Mawdsley, we produced a cartoon book, “A Joke Too Far”, which was printed and published by Pegasus Press.

Since then, I have tried out various mediums to produce my artworks, and have now settled on portraiture as my preferred topic.

 

All of my artworks are completed using either, Acrylic, Oils, Airbrush, or a mixture of the three. And are sealed in either Matt, Satin or High Gloss varnish, depending on the customers requirements.

 

My style of painting has been described as Powerful, Thought-Provoking, with a Twist.
